Today? Replaced 3 peanut bulbs...In the past 3-4 weeks, I installed the Eibach Pro kit springs (I'd heard 1" drop, HOWEVER, I only realized a 0.5" drop as I guess my orig springs had softened 0.5"), went with KYB-G2 struts, replaced the lower control arms with new OEM Supra LCA's (it works perfect and saved me many hundreds, thank you so much for this great info Club Lexus members! Never would have known otherwise), sway bar links, fixed the lower plastic front drip pan with copper rivets and aluminum strapping to repair split and keep it nice and tight, sealed the repair with black caulking (Lexus wanted $900 for a large piece of plastic..really?) , replaced the seat ECM control but (looks like a motor needs replacing though). Bladed off the gold pinstripes, people were pointing and laughing...sheesh...Replaced Group 27 battery with Group 33 (same CCA) to lose a few pounds,,,To Do: Adding a M3 rear trunk spoiler Friday and looks more like i have to do the power steering pump (leaking usually =blown right?) before the alternator gets bombed. All improvements have made a huge difference. Last month I added 225 40 18's on Enkei F5 but they are a little firm and i wish I went with 45's for more cushion and fill-in, I also lost 4 MPH on my speedo....but they look fab. Next week or so, i start Tom Renshaw's BFI 4.3 mod..and new red/smoke taillights..I just hate these orange taillights, they are brutal.. Every improvement makes makes me that much prouder to own it....(one thing I am wanting : original front lower spoiler, black, again Lexus dealer wants $950, not a chance..I hear they are hard to find as they get scraped off and too $ to replace... Why does every part on my SC400 seem to cost $700-900?? All the best...
